A novel and simple strategy for the direct synthesis bimetallic mesoporous materials Zr-La-SBA-15

摘要

A series of Zr and La incorporated SBA-15 mesoporous materials (ZLS) were synthesized through a direct hydrothermal route without addition of mineral acids and characterized by FT-IR, XRD, TEM and N_2 adsorption-desorption isotherm techniques. The results indicated that the heteroatoms were successfully incorporated into the framework of SBA-15 after modification. The modified materials still preserved a desirable ordered two-dimensional P6mm hexagonal structure and possessed high specific surface area, large pore volume and narrow pore size distribution.
机译:通过直接水热法合成了一系列Zr和La结合的SBA-15介孔材料(ZLS),无需添加无机酸,并通过FT-IR,XRD,TEM和N_2吸附-解吸等温线技术进行了表征。结果表明,杂原子在修饰后成功地掺入了SBA-15的骨架中。改性后的材料仍保留了理想的有序二维P6mm六角形结构,并具有较高的比表面积,较大的孔体积和较窄的孔径分布。
